What is a Physical Disability?

A physical disability refers to a significant, enduring condition that impacts a person’s bodily function, often affecting mobility, endurance, or manual dexterity. Each physical disability is distinct, impacting individuals in various ways and manifesting different symptoms. These disabilities can impose restrictions on an individual’s capacity to carry out everyday activities. Challenges may arise in actions such as walking, sitting, standing, controlling specific muscles, or moving limbs.

Below you’ll find just some of the services we provide:

  • Balance your duties – maintain your work schedule and manage everyday living tasks.
  • Stay socially engaged – catch up with friends and family, continue your education or club activities, or enjoy your favorite hobbies.
  • Prioritize health and fitness – keep up with medical appointments, maintain a healthy diet, or visit a fitness center.
  • Support your independence – assistance with grocery shopping and bill payments.
  • Uphold your daily routine – help with personal morning and evening rituals, like bed-making and dental hygiene.
  • Maintain a clean and orderly home – aid with housekeeping tasks such as laundry and ironing.
  • Tailored to your needs, our carers can visit just once or twice a week, or offer round-the-clock home care, depending on the level of support you require.
